    Abstract: Multiple components of a computer system may be capable of entering wake and sleep states. The power consumption of a processor during wake state may draw significant amount of current. In order to keep power consumption of a voltage regulator low, a two-phase voltage regulator may be used during wake state. During sleep state, since power consumption is lower, the two-phase voltage regulator may be operated in a single-phase mode to further reduce voltage regulator power consumption.

    Abstract: A system and method of constructing cluster views may involve determining that a process such as an application server process having an IP address is stopped. Another IP address may be assigned to the process in response to determining that the process is stopped, wherein the other IP address is dedicated to processes that are stopped. If a connection request for the process is received at the other IP address, the connection request may be actively refused. The active refusal may significantly reduce the amount of time required to generate cluster views.

    Abstract: A system and method of reclaiming lost Internet customers may involve detecting an outage condition associated with a host of an electronic commerce (e-commerce) web site. Customer data can be extracted from packets destined for the host, wherein the packets could be associated with transactions between customers and the web site. The extracted customer data may be stored and, upon detecting a resolution of the outage condition, a customer database can be searched based on the extracted customer data in order to identify customer contact information. A customer reclamation message may then be sent to the customer, wherein the message can incentivize the customer to return to the web site and request completion of the transaction.

    Abstract: An irrigation system has a water distribution system, a controller, and a pet monitoring system. The controller may modify an irrigation setting of the water distribution system based on a pet elimination signal from the pet monitoring system. The pet elimination signal may correspond to an event such as a pet urination event.

    Abstract: In one embodiment, an air mover may include a first electrode, a second electrode and an ionization device to selectively ionize molecules in an electric field between the first and second electrodes. The ionized molecules can drive airflow between the first and second electrodes. In certain embodiments, the ionization device has an operational characteristic that prevents ionization of oxygen so that the airflow is ozone-free.
